Filters Applied
Clear All- Some College (9)
- Bachelors (212)
- Masters (264)
- Doctorate (20)
Masters / Information Technology Remote Software Development Python Jobs
Technical Lead/Director
Key Responsibilities Act as the primary technical contact for clients, leading discussions and translating business requirements into technology solutions Oversee the software development lifecycle, ensuring high-quality code delivery and adherence...development experience, including front-end development with React 4+ years in a leadership role managing technical teams of 10-15 members Experience with Adobe Experience Manager (AEM) and backend technologies such as Node.js or Java Familiarity
Software Engineer for wmA
Key Responsibilities Support a team of software engineers in developing software products and solutions Collaborate with cross-functional teams to define project requirements and ensure successful delivery Assist in the professional growth and mentorship...languages and development methodologies Experience in a leadership or mentoring capacity Familiarity with software development methodologies and best practices
Software Engineer II
Key Responsibilities Contribute to full-cycle software development, from architecture design to deployment Collaborate with cross-functional teams for seamless integration into Systems-of-Systems Mentor junior engineers and interns while managing
- GET ACCESSAccess New Remote Job Listings Now
Create a free account to begin your remote job search with our expert-vetted listings, resume tips, and career tools.
Freelance AI Coding Tutor
A company is looking for a Freelance Software Developer (Rust) - Company Trainer....Development, Computer Science, or related fields At least 3 years of professional experience with Rust Code review experience is required Experience with Company projects is a plus Advanced level of English (C1) or above
Remote AI Coding Tutor
A company is looking for a Freelance Software Developer (Rust) - Company Trainer....Development, Computer Science, or related fields At least 3 years of professional experience with Rust Code review experience is a must Experience with Company projects is a plus Advanced level of English (C1) or above
Business Analyst
Key Responsibilities Support software engineers in developing software products and solutions, providing guidance and technical support Collaborate with cross-functional teams to define project requirements for successful software project delivery...languages and development methodologies Experience in a leadership or mentoring capacity Familiarity with software development methodologies and best practices
Senior Firmware Engineer
Key Responsibilities Design and develop real-time embedded system software for complex machines Conduct requirements development, coding, testing, debugging, and documentation of embedded software components Collaborate on design and code reviews,...and integrate hardware/software development tests Required Qualifications 5+ years of experience in embedded software, hardware, or firmware development Bachelor's degree in Computer Engineering, Electrical Engineering, or Computer Science Extensive
Software Engineer
and application deployment Collaborate with design, product, and engineering teams on project execution Contribute to the evolution of the codebase and participate in team planning and goal-setting Required Qualifications 6+ years of professional software...development experience Experience collaborating with product and design stakeholders Ability to work across the stack both independently and collaboratively Strong understanding of web frameworks, APIs, and databases Proven sense of ownership and
Senior Software Engineer
development code Participate in or lead design reviews with peers and stakeholders Triage product or system issues and debug/track/resolve them Required Qualifications Bachelor's degree or equivalent practical experience 5 years of experience with software...development in one or more programming languages 3 years of experience testing, maintaining, or launching software products Experience in Generative AI and machine learning algorithms 1 year of experience with software design and architecture
Software Engineering Manager
Key Responsibilities Oversee the team's software development process Design and develop features by collaborating with various teams Provide technical guidance and mentorship to engineers Required Qualifications Bachelor's degree in Computer Science